概括
瓜尔由肠道微生物发酵,改变了它们的功能和组成. 不断的消费导致微生物的适应,表明作为一种前生物成分的潜力.

背景情况:
- 瓜尔是一种常见的食品添加剂,但其发酵和对肠道微生物群的影响尚未完全理解.
- 调查瓜尔在调节结肠微生物群中的作用对于了解其对健康的影响至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 评估肠道微生物群对瓜尔的代谢反应.
- 为了确定瓜尔发酵的程度和随后的肠道微生物适应.
主要方法:
- 一项概念验证研究涉及12名健康的男性,他们每天消费8克瓜尔,持续18天.
- 测量包括气体疏散,消化系统的感觉和便微生物群通过猎枪测序进行分析.
- 微生物群的组成和功能在瓜尔的初始和后期阶段进行了分析.
主要成果:
- 最初的瓜尔摄入量暂时增加了气体和消化不适,随着持续的消费,这些不适部分降低了.
- 瓜尔诱导了肠道微生物群组成和功能的中度变化.
- 特定的细菌,包括*Agathobaculum butyriciproducens*和*Lachnospira pectinoschiza*,繁殖,与快乐感相关联.
结论:
- 瓜尔被肠道微生物群代谢,导致微生物分类学和功能的选择性适应.
- 持续的瓜尔消费显示了开发新型益生菌成分的潜力.
- 这些发现支持瓜尔口香糖在调节肠道微生物群的功效,对健康有好处.

Bacterial Flora of the Large Intestine
527
The gut microbiome is formed by a vast and diverse community of bacteria that colonizes our large intestine. These bacteria start residing in the gut from birth and continue diversifying throughout life, influenced by factors such as diet, lifestyle, and stress. The gut bacterial community also includes bacteria from food and those that enter the colon through the anus.
The normal gut flora of the colon plays a critical role in generating essential vitamins such as vitamins K, B5, and B7.

What is Monogastric Digestion?
71.6K
The human body contains a monogastric digestive system. In a monogastric digestive system, the stomach only contains one chamber in which it digests food. Several other animal species also have monogastric digestive systems, including pigs, horses, dogs, and birds. This chapter, however, focuses on the human digestive system.
